I actually didn't care too much for that interaction between Tywin and Olenna, as much as those 2 characters have been great on the show. Olenna's banter felt too modern or something. Her trying to tease Tywin about his boyhood "experiences" felt kind of... meh.

I don't think they're making Tywin out to be a homophobe within the world of GoT. Sure, maybe looking at him from our POV you might think that. But he doesn't give a **** about Loras' sexuality really beyond the practicality of Loras acting as the heir to Highgarden and being able to produce offspring. Being gay might make the whole producing offspring part a bit less likely if he isn't inclined to get with a woman.

I'll have to watch the episode again however. I'm probably missing something. Good episode but not quite as good as the last couple have been. It had some really lovely looking and well composed shots but the writing was a bit hamfisted at times- Littlefinger gave a nice speech there with the montage but I wish they would tone down Littlefinger's outright villainy and outward scheming. Make the guy a bit more of an enigma like he is in the books.

Actually, her snapping his quill was basically her giving in to his proposal: either allow Loras to marry Cersei or Tywin will make him a Kingsguard instead, which will make him un-marriable (is that a word? lol) and the Tyrell name will have that much less of a future.  Is that how the rest of you took that?

#4270
LPPrince

LPPrince
  • Members
  • 55 000 messages
Yeah, its pretty obvious that Tywin won the exchange with Olenna Tyrell.

She snaps the quill, saying that "Its rare to meet a man that lives up to his name", basically submitting to Tywin's wishes.

Then later, you have Tyrion telling Sansa(with Shae watching and listening) about their predicament. That hasn't changed- Sansa is now slated to marry Tyrion, and Cersei is now slated to marry Loras.

Tywin trounced everyone involved- Tyrion, Cersei, Loras, Sansa, and Lady Olenna.
